S$30.8m awarded to projects to improve living spaces

Projects that made the final cut in the Land and Liveability National Innovation Challenge (L2 NIC) include one by SMU iCity Lab, which proposes the use of sensors to support ageing-in-place. With the installation of sensors in the homes of the elderly, community volunteers could monitor and respond to seniors' calls for help in a timelier manner.
